About the Role:
Fermilab's Finance & Procurement Division seeks an On Call Financial Analysis. The On Call Financial Analysis will create and interpret moderately complex financial statements and reports in a specific accounting area. This individual will compile financial information, process transactions, and execute control procedures. The Financial Analysis will exercises independent decision-making in assigned general area of responsibility.

What your day-to-day as an On Call Financial Analysis at Fermilab will look like:

  • Prepare moderately complex financial statements/reports for management, the Department of Energy, taxing bodies, and others within or outside the Laboratory.
  • Develop and interpret moderately complex ad-hoc reports and analyses to respond to information needs of management and others within or outside the laboratory.
  • Create or extensively modify ad-hoc queries using the system query tool to meet the information needs in area of assignment.
  • Record, classify and summarize accounting transactions in accordance with generally accepted accounting principles.
  • Analyze moderately complex problems or discrepancies and execute corrective action or provides supervisor with analysis and recommended action.
  • Reconcile complex sub-ledgers to the general ledger and resolves differences.
  • Assist in controlling the monthly and year-end close processes.
  • Create and transmit sensitive, confidential and/or time-critical data to third parties.
  • Provide recommendations for the development or revision of policies and procedures.
  • Develop test cases and/or execute testing related to the implementation or upgrade of financial software applications.
  • Assist supervisor in identifying, reporting, testing, and resolving/implementing system problems/enhancements.
  • Communicate with employees, users and outside individuals or organizations about accounting transactions in assigned area and resolves issues and discrepancies.
  • Maintain accounting records pertinent to assigned area, including procedure manual.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by supervisor.
  • Abide by and is responsible for performing all duties in accordance with all environmental, health and safety regulations and practices pertinent to this position.

Why Fermilab:
Fermilab is America's premier laboratory for particle physics and accelerator research, funded by the U.S. Department of Energy. We support discovery science experiments in Illinois and locations around the world, including deep underground mines in South Dakota and Canada, mountaintops in Arizona and Chile, CERN in Europe and the South Pole.

HSPD-12

In accordance with Homeland Security Presidential Directive 12 (HSPD-12) new employees are required to obtain and maintain a HSPD-12 Personal Identity Verification (PIV) Credential. To obtain this credential, new employees must successfully complete and pass a federal background check investigation. This investigation includes a declaration of illegal drug activities, including use, supply, possession, or manufacture. This includes marijuana and cannabis derivatives, which are still considered illegal under federal law, regardless of state laws. Failure to obtain or maintain such government access authorization could result in the withdrawal of a job offer or future termination of employment.
